#include <stdio.h>
#include <stdlib.h>
#include "cvodes.h"
#include "cvdense.h"
#include "nvector_serial.h"
#include "sbmlsolver/cvodedata.h"
#include "sbmlsolver/processAST.h"
#include "sbmlsolver/odeModel.h"
#include "sbmlsolver/variableIndex.h"
#include "sbmlsolver/solverError.h"
#include "sbmlsolver/integratorInstance.h"
#include "sbmlsolver/cvodeSolver.h"
#include "sbmlsolver/sensSolver.h"
Include dependency graph for sensSolver.c:
Functions | |
void | fS (int Ns, realtype t, N_Vector y, N_Vector ydot, int iS, N_Vector yS, N_Vector ySdot, void *fS_data, N_Vector tmp1, N_Vector tmp2) |
fS routine: Called by CVODES to compute the sensitivity RHS for one parameter. | |
int | IntegratorInstance_getForwardSens (integratorInstance_t *engine) |
Calls CVODES to provide forward sensitivities after a call to cvodeOneStep. | |
int | IntegratorInstance_createCVODESSolverStructures (integratorInstance_t *engine) |
SBML_ODESOLVER_API void | IntegratorInstance_printCVODESStatistics (integratorInstance_t *engine, FILE *f) |
Prints some final statistics of the calls to CVODES forward sensitivity analysis routines. |